'''Richard Morgan "Ric" Fliehr'''({{lahirmati|[[Memphis, Tennessee]]|25|2|1949}}) adalah Mantan pegulat profesional asal [[Amerika Serikat]]. dia terkenal Nama Panggilan di Ring yaitu Ric Flair dan ia berkarier 40 tahun dalam bergulat. Dia terdaftar di National Wrestling Alliance (NWA),[[World Championship Wrestling]] (WCW),[[World Wrestling Entertainment|World Wrestling Federation]] (WWF) diubah menjadi [[World Wrestling Entertainment|World Wrestling Entertainmen]]<nowiki/>t (WWE) dan [[TNA Wrestling|Total Nonstop Action Wrestling]] (TNA). Dia Pernah Memegang Sabuk NWA World Heavyweight Champion 8 Kali, WCW World Heavyweight Champion 6 Kali dan WWF Champion 2 Kali ditotal menjadi 16 Kali.

1 {{note|1}} <small>Flair did win the Mid-Atlantic version of the NWA United States Championships six times and the six reigns were recognized even after World Championship Wrestling took control over the championship and renamed it the WCW United States Heavyweight Championship in 1991. After WCW's purchase by WWE, the lineage of the championships were kept in the WWE United States Championship. WWE.com has published contradictory information on Flair's reigns - recognizing five reigns in one article, but describing him as a six-time champion in another article.</small><br />
2 {{note|2}} <small>His last four reigns with the championship were after Jim Crockett Jr. sold his promotion to Ted Turner in November 1988, which became World Championship Wrestling. The NWA World Heavyweight Championship was defended exclusively in WCW until WCW's withdrawal from the National Wrestling Alliance in 1993.</small>
